Cute granny owner manning this monjayaki small shop. There's only 6 tables and the place only had locals, so don't expect any English. But do expect delicious food and cheap prices. I wound up ordering more stuff off their menu because of how cheap it was.
I ordered their mixed monjayaki, then went with pork kimchi okonomoyaki. Both were delicious and I would recommend searching how to cook monjayaki. The owner does show you how to do it, but definitely helps to see how it's done once you see how the locals do it so casually...
